There is reason to be happy in Koblenz: the pedestrian zone at the Karthause shopping center was recently redesigned and now surprises visitors with generous plantings and comfortable seating. The project, which is seen as a model project for future developments, was ceremoniously handed over to the public. Head of the building department Andreas Lukas explained that the measure represents a step forward not only in terms of design but also financially. The Aldi company in particular contributed financially to the redesign, which gives the measure additional weight. Planned measures for a better quality of stay
A central point of the new design is the elimination of two wide raised beds that previously acted as a barrier. Instead, new meeting and communication areas should be created. Large mobile pots for fresh greenery are also planned, as well as the renewal of the seating options, which were previously rather uncomfortable. Modern seating is planned to replace worn-out benches, while the outdated lighting needs a refresh. In addition, the old paving will be replaced with uniform, modern concrete paving.

These construction measures are also part of a larger project that is linked to insulation work on the adjacent private underground car park. The costs will be shared between the city and the owners, with the FREIEN VÖHLER also planning to apply for funds to redevelop the surrounding areas in the upcoming budget consultations. The adjacent urban areas, such as the Dreifaltigkeitshaus in the south and the Karthäuser JuBüz in the north, have not yet been planned, which leaves room for future developments.
